To answer your questions, I hazard to guess that a low DCR power supply is a useless investment for a phone preamp application. The change is current draw for a phono preamp, which only has to swing a few volts, is minimal.There is another approach. If you have been reading John Broskie's excellent web site (www.tubecad.com), he has for many years pushed the importance of 'constant current draw' by each stage of an amplifier. For example, a differential amplifier will draw a constant current from the power supply, a behavior that pretty much eliminates a need for a 'low DCR' supply. John goes into other configurations with this property.
